New York, New York by Marriott…..shopping and hotel mecca
Marriott Hotels’ 12 New York hotels rocked up in Sydney and Melbourne this week to promote the Big Apple’s Marriott properties and according to Leon Goldberg, [pictured right] the New York Marriott Marquis’ Director of Sales and Marketing, the properties have recently undergone a $2 billion refurbishment, with Leon also revealing to assembled guests at the Sydney Circular Quay Marriott that tourism to the Big Apple is booming.
Leon said that Australians represent the fifth largest market into New York city and stay for an average of seven days.
Marriott has hotels though the Manhattan and also in Brooklyn, which is also booming, with all brands, including Marriott, Residence, Renaissance and Courtyard by Marriott brands represented.

The Marquis is unquestionably a New York landmark, also offering five restaurants, with The View, New York’s only revolving roof top restaurant, the subject of a $4 million renovation.
